- 2 8-ounce packages cream cheese, softened
- 1 2.5-ounce jar dried beef, finely chopped
- 1/4 cup green onions finely sliced
- 1 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
- 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1/2 teaspoon onion powder
- 1/4 teaspoon cayenne pepper optional, for heat
- 1/2 cup shredded cheddar cheese
- 1/4 cup finely chopped pecans optional, for coating
- Crackers pretzels, or veggie sticks (for serving)
Prepare the Base
In a large mixing bowl, combine the softened cream cheese, Worcestershire sauce, garlic powder, onion powder, and cayenne pepper. Mix thoroughly until smooth.
- Always soften cream cheese for easier mixing.
- Chill time is essential for the flavors to meld.
